Zygomorphic
Zygomorphic or bilateral (or irregular) - also known as monosymmetric.
- divided into equal halves along one (longitudinal) plane only, or in other words,
- divisible through the centre of the flower in only one longitudinal plane for the halves of the flower to be mirror images.
